WebOct 21, 2024 · Next-generation COVID-19 boosters are replacing the original booster formula for people ages 5 and older (Pfizer) and 6 and older (Moderna). The new shots are bivalent, meaning they protect against both the original COVID-19 and newer Omicron variants, such as BA.4 and BA.5. The COVID-19 booster shots are getting an upgrade. Web(VRBPAC) met to publicly discuss whether a change to the current vaccine strain composition of COVID-19 vaccines for booster doses is necessary for the 2024 fall and winter seasons. The advisory committee voted in favor of including a SARS-CoV-2 Omicron component in COVID-19 vaccines that would be used for boosters in the United States ...
